Default Cell Restrictions

I need to find a way to keep users from entering the formula (=TODAY())
in a cell that requires today's date.

Cell validation doesn't work because the formula produces a result
within the accepted range.

Is the anyway to "turn off" formulas in a cell?

Any help would be greatly appreciated.
